regarding the quality of the electronic points.

Lumention Magnetronic is about £110 (bloody hell)

My first one lasted about 8 years and then it died. The replacement (another £90 or so) has lasted 12+ years.

Then you have £30 plastic wonders on ebay. These do work and are cheap enough to happily replace.

Both use the same technology (Hall effect) but there are simple ways of operating them and more involved ways.

I haven't a clue if the price reflects the quality of the circuit or even if a better quality HE sensor is used

My thought on the difference between the Lumenition and the Ebay Wonder is the construction materials.

The Lumenition has a metal body, the cheapo has a plastic body. Heat is usually the enemy of electronics

Has anybody done a comparison between the various examples of life, heat build up etc.

I would go for the Lumenition simply because of the better construction.

 

Replacement of the module after a failure is quick and easy compared to the standard points.

However the beauty of the standard points is they have an agonosing death and thankfully do it over a longish period.
